Okay, now that we have briefly talked about why we should care about money, let's start with some fundamentals. I want to start with the mind. Mindset is the first piece of the puzzle. If we want to make fundamental changes, we must have the right mindset. Without it, we cannot get that far, and we are here to run a marathon called life.
I want to zoom out a bit. We are here for the "Financial Independence," you would say. But allow me to talk to you about something a bit bigger than that. A successful life. A life with a great sense of fulfillment.
See, everyone will try to tell you what a successful life should look like, and we are constantly bombarded by a ton of information, and you feel that you are pulled into many different directions. At the end of the day, you think that you are not living the life you deserve. But what is that life? What does success mean to you?
The idea here is to identify what makes us feel at peace with ourselves. Identify what success means to you. There isn't any blueprint that works for everyone; you should get to your own definition. Otherwise, you will never feel successful. Health, finances or family are parts of your life's whole pie. Each piece of your life's pie has its own priority, and you get to decide what the pieces are, but you must define them.
Once we have defined our definition of success, we will have our north star and know what to think about when we are at our lowest and highest points. We will have that element that grounds us and push us forward. So when challenges come our way and try to make us deviate from our purpose, we can shake it off and continue going forward.
While working on your definition of success, consider being reasonable and seek balance. This should keep us moving forward, not something that should bring stress and pain. Think that you are writing your definition with a pencil; your definition is not set in stone, but you have to start somewhere.
Here are some steps that you can take:
- 🔬 Self-Exploration: Take the time to think about what truly matters to you, considering your passions, values and what brings a sense of fulfillment to your life. Include all the areas, i.e. health, career, relationships, personal growth, etc.
- 😎 Visualize Your Ideal Life: Imagine what a successful life looks like for you. What achievements or milestones would you like to reach? How would you want to feel on a daily basis? Picture your ideal lifestyle and the things that would make you content.
- 🔝 Prioritize: Recognize that different areas of your life may require different levels of attention at different times. Decide which aspects are most important to you right now and prioritize them accordingly.
- 📓 Make a Plan: Once you have a clearer idea of what success means to you, outline actionable steps you can take to achieve it. This plan should be realistic and achievable, keeping in mind the time and resources you have available.
- ⚖️ Seek Balance: Remember that personal success isn't just about achievements; it's also about balance. Consider how various aspects of your life (work, relationships, health, leisure) fit together and contribute to your overall well-being. Check this guided exercise.
- 🎉 Celebrate Progress: Acknowledge your achievements along the way, no matter how small. Celebrating milestones reinforces your sense of success and keeps you motivated.
Going through this exercise will help you carve out a definition of personal success that is meaningful to you and guides you toward a fulfilling life. This is your life, your journey; make it the best one you will live.
